All right, you got a good looker too! I don't know what it takes to kill these things. They just seem to run for ever. I have had several of those 5hp T models over the years. Some where pretty beat up, but I can't recall ever not being able to make one go. I use 24:1 mix, and 90wt gear oil. Be a little carefull with the ignition, as those parts are becoming harder to find, and cost too much when you find them. They have little bake-a-lite sticks that open the points. They stick sometimes. Just clean the contacts and lightly oil those sticks. A friend gave me a TD about two years ago.
